
Varada Sethu shares her reaction to some of the criticism about her Doctor Who exit. Sethu appeared in one episode of season 14, but was added to the cast of Doctor Who season 15 as the Doctor’s companion, Belinda Chandra. Belinda became an unwilling companion after being saved by the Doctor and only wants to get back to Earth.
The Doctor Who season 15 finale saw Belinda become the mother of a young girl, Poppy. Poppy was created as the result of a wish, which originally had her as the daughter of the Doctor and Belinda. However, after reality is changed, Poppy is shown to still have Belinda as her mother, but a human father. Some viewers found this to be a poor way for Belinda to leave the show, as she had motherhood forced upon her.
In an interview with MTV UK (via RadioTimes), Sethu responds to the criticism around her departure. She shares that the majority of the reactions she has seen are positive, and thinks some of the negativity is “a bit unfair.” Sethu believes that Belinda’s story was tied up perfectly. Check out her comments below:
I feel like the majority – it was so much love. Reactions that always make me laugh… it’s a bit unfair because I think the writing was beautiful. I think it was tied up in a way that was perfect, I cannot think of a better way of completing that circle.
But it’s always like, ‘Oh, I can’t believe I won’t get to see Belinda’. It’s a frustration that comes from people loving Belinda so much that they’re like, ‘I can’t believe I don’t get more.’
What This Means For Doctor Who
The Finale Had Some Big Surprises
The most recent Doctor Who finale had plenty of big surprises. Along with Sethu, Ncuti Gatwa also exited the show after just two seasons. In the closing moments of the finale, Gatwa’s Doctor regenerates into a character played by former Doctor Who star Billie Piper. It is unknown if Piper will be playing the Sixteenth Doctor, but that is the most likely explanation at this point.

There is a possibility that Belinda could return to the sci-fi series. One prevailing theory is that Poppy is Susan Foreman’s mother, the Doctor’s granddaughter. If that turns out to be true, it would make sense to have Sethu return as Belinda. Depending on how this potential storyline could be handled, it may make Belinda’s arc more satisfactory to viewers.
